//引入Menu模块const{Menu,remote}=require('electron')//添加到ready调用的函数中letmenu=Menu.buildFromTemplate(template);Menu.setApplicationMenu(menu);//Menu.setApplicationMenu(null); //这个是不显示菜单栏的效果 这样会出现一个名为 Hello 菜单, 点开的效果大概是这样的. ...
[] X </template> exportdefault{ data(){return{ } },methods:{ min(){this.$electron.ipcRenderer.send('window-min'); }, max(){this.$electron.ipcRenderer.send('window-max'); }, close(){this.$electron.ipcRenderer.send('window-close'); } } } #myHeader { width:100%; heig...
做到这一步的时候基本上鼠标在我们的托盘图标商滑入滑出的时候,控制菜单栏的显示和隐藏;但是会发现一个问题,当我们鼠标滑动到菜单栏的窗口时就会隐藏掉菜单栏,这样子根本做不了什么操作。所以还要在我们第一步鉴定托盘位置时将整个菜单栏的窗口划入到我们系统托盘滑动的正常范围内: /** * 检查鼠标是否从托盘离开 ...
看下效果图:const { Menu } = require('electron') const menu = Menu.getApplicationMenu() // 获取要隐藏的菜单将其属性visible设置为false menu.items[3].submenu.items[2].visible = false; 如图所示:刚开始可以看到view的子菜单Toggle Developer Tools切换调试窗口,点击执行隐藏该菜单,这时通过快捷键cmd+...
/*隐藏electron创听的菜单栏*/ Menu.setApplicationMenu(null) 1. 2. 3. 4. 5. 6. 现在electron已经不需要通过通过remote模块来使用Menu,可以直接通过Menu模块来渲染 const { app, BrowserWindow , Menu} = require('electron'); let win;
// 隐藏菜单栏 Menu.setApplicationMenu(null) // Create the browser window.设置窗口宽高,最小宽高,图标等 mainWindow = new BrowserWindow({ width: 800, height: 600, minWidth: 1280, minHeight: 800, resizable: false, allowRunningInsecureContent: true, experimentalCanvasFeatures: true, icon: './...
1. 菜单栏菜单: Electron提供的默认菜单栏中的菜单都是一些为了演示和开发使用的,在实际的应用中我们还是需要进行配置来实现我们自己的功能。菜单栏自动隐藏,应用启动后默认隐藏,当按下ALT件后显示原菜单栏: 代码语言:javascript 复制 constwin=newBrowserWindow({autoHideMenuBar:true,}) ...
隐藏菜单栏 在main/index.js中修改ready事件回调 隐藏导航栏 在初始化BrowserWindow的配置参数中, windows添加 Mac添加 修改后如下: ...
隐藏electron窗体菜单栏的几种方式 方法1: const electron = require('electron') const Menu = electron.Menu function createWindow (){ Menu.setApplicationMenu(null) } 方法2: new BrowserWindow({autoHideMenuBar: true}) 方法3: new BrowserWindow({frame: false})...